Special Report: SD Schools Flagged For Earthquake Risks Left Unchecked

August 11, 2011 10:11 a.m.

Children go to school in roughly 200 buildings across San Diego County where earthquake safety is still an unanswered question. It's the result of a long string of shortcomings in how California and its school districts have handled seismic safety.
